How to create Touch Bar screenshots on a MacBook Pro

The Mac’s Touch Bar is actually a second, mini-display. Which means you can take a screenshot of whatever it’s displaying.

By default, ⇧⌘6 (Shift, Command, 6) will save a screenshot of Touch Bar as a file on your desktop. Alternatively, pressing  ⌃⇧⌘6 (Control, Shift, Command, 6) will copy what you see on Touch Bar to your clipboard for pasting in an app.

You can customize which keyboard shortcut does what by going to System Preferences → Keyboard → Shortcuts → Screen Shots and selecting the key combination for both Touch Bar shortcuts. 

You can also create a button on Touch Bar’s Control Strip for creating screenshots of your Mac display. Go to System Preferences → Keyboard → Customize Control Strip. Drag and drop the screenshot button where you want it on Touch Bar.
